Grilled Gorgonzola Cheese and Bacon Sandwich
prep: 10 minutes
cook: 10 minutes
you’ll need…
1 cup arugula
1/2 teaspoon balsamic vinegar (or more to taste)
fresh ground black pepper to taste
2 slices dark rye bread
1 slice (about 2 ounces) gorgonzola cheese
1 slice cooked crispy bacon, chopped
1 slice (about 1 ounce) Swiss cheese
1 tablespoon butter, softened
let’s get to it…
Toss together the arugula and vinegar in small bowl. Sprinkle with fresh ground black pepper; set aside.
Top 1 bread slice with gorgonzola cheese, bacon, arugula and Swiss cheese; cover with remaining bread slice.
Spread outside of sandwich with butter.
Cook in a skillet on medium heat 3 minutes; carefully turn and cook another 2 to 3 minutes or until cheese is melted.
